Admission Requirements

Academic Requirements

You need the following GPA score:

Required score: 3

Applicants for graduate programs must have the equivalent of a bachelor\xe2\x80\x99s degree with a minimum GPA equivalent to 3 on a US 4.0 grading scale. Admitted applicants typically have an undergraduate GPA of or better on a 4.0 scale. No exam grade should be lower than 4.5 (European grade scale) or D (American grade scale).

Your GPA (Grade Point Average) is calculated using the grades that you received in each course, and is determined by the points assigned to each grade (e.g. for the US grading scale from A-F).

Admission requirements:
  • Bachelor\'s degree from an accredited college or university with a 3.0 GPA or better. Admitted students usually have GPAs that are higher than 3.0. The major must have an equivalent at the State University of New York (SUNY)
  • Official transcripts from all post-secondary schools.
  • Official GRE (verbal, quantitative, and analytical) scores are required
  • Three references from persons who can address the applicant\'s capacity to provide leadership in public health and complete a course of graduate study.
  • One essay is required for the application. It should be no more than 500 words and should be submitted with your application in SOPHAS.

English Proficiency: IELTS 6.5 or equivalent.
